Grantham is a town in Sullivan County, New Hampshire, United States. The population was 3,404 at the 2020 census, an increase over the figure of 2,985 tabulated in 2010. The planned community of Eastman is in the eastern part of the town. Grantham is situated 4 miles northeast of The Pinacle Cemetery.

Guild is an unincorporated community in the town of Newport in Sullivan County, New Hampshire, United States. It is located near the eastern boundary of Newport, along New Hampshire Routes 11 and 103. Guild is situated 5 miles southeast of The Pinacle Cemetery.
